That photo of Dave Hickson heading home is a fantastic photo. Any kids reading - that’s how you head a ball. Smack on the forehead, eyes wide open.
I’m almost sure the player in the background is Stan Milburn when he was with Leicester. I saw him loads of times when he was at Rochdale. One day shortly after he’d retired I was walking across the warehouse of the place I was working at and who should be walking the other way pushing a sack truck but Stan.! Can you see that happening with today’s players. He played for and coached the works team until he was past 50. A lovely bloke with no edge at all. He was Bobby and Jack Charlton’s uncle.
